Subject: [PATCH 21/21] block/backup-top: drop .active
Date: Mon, 23 Nov 2020 23:12:33 +0300 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20201123201233.9534-24-vsementsov@virtuozzo.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20201123201233.9534-1-vsementsov@virtuozzo.com>
We don't need this workaround anymore: bdrv_append is already smart
enough and we can use new bdrv_drop_filter().

diff --git a/block/backup-top.c b/block/backup-top.c
index 650ed6195c..84eb73aeb7 100644
--- a/block/backup-top.c
+++ b/block/backup-top.c
@@ -37,7 +37,6 @@
typedef struct BDRVBackupTopState {
BlockCopyState *bcs;
BdrvChild *target;
- bool active;
int64_t cluster_size;
} BDRVBackupTopState;
@@ -127,21 +126,6 @@ static void backup_top_child_perm(BlockDriverState *bs, BdrvChild *c,
uint64_t perm, uint64_t shared,
uint64_t *nperm, uint64_t *nshared)
{
- BDRVBackupTopState *s = bs->opaque;
-
- if (!s->active) {
- /*
- * The filter node may be in process of bdrv_append(), which firstly do
- * bdrv_set_backing_hd() and then bdrv_replace_node(). This means that
- * we can't unshare BLK_PERM_WRITE during bdrv_append() operation. So,
- * let's require nothing during bdrv_append() and refresh permissions
- * after it (see bdrv_backup_top_append()).
- */
- *nperm = 0;
- *nshared = BLK_PERM_ALL;
- return;
- }
-
if (!(role & BDRV_CHILD_FILTERED)) {
/*
* Target child
@@ -229,18 +213,6 @@ BlockDriverState *bdrv_backup_top_append(BlockDriverState *source,
}
appended = true;
- /*
- * bdrv_append() finished successfully, now we can require permissions
- * we want.
- */
- state->active = true;
- bdrv_child_refresh_perms(top, top->backing, &local_err);
- if (local_err) {
- error_prepend(&local_err,
- "Cannot set permissions for backup-top filter: ");
- goto fail;
- }
-
state->cluster_size = cluster_size;
state->bcs = block_copy_state_new(top->backing, state->target,
cluster_size, write_flags, &local_err);
@@ -256,7 +228,6 @@ BlockDriverState *bdrv_backup_top_append(BlockDriverState *source,
fail:
if (appended) {
- state->active = false;
bdrv_backup_top_drop(top);
} else {
bdrv_unref(top);
@@ -272,16 +243,9 @@ void bdrv_backup_top_drop(BlockDriverState *bs)
{
BDRVBackupTopState *s = bs->opaque;
- bdrv_drained_begin(bs);
+ bdrv_drop_filter(bs, &error_abort);
block_copy_state_free(s->bcs);
- s->active = false;
- bdrv_child_refresh_perms(bs, bs->backing, &error_abort);
- bdrv_replace_node(bs, bs->backing->bs, &error_abort);
- bdrv_set_backing_hd(bs, NULL, &error_abort);
-
- bdrv_drained_end(bs);
-
bdrv_unref(bs);
}
diff --git a/tests/qemu-iotests/283.out b/tests/qemu-iotests/283.out
index fbb7d0f619..a34e4e3f92 100644
--- a/tests/qemu-iotests/283.out
+++ b/tests/qemu-iotests/283.out
@@ -5,4 +5,4 @@
{"execute": "blockdev-add", "arguments": {"driver": "blkdebug", "image": "base", "node-name": "other", "take-child-perms": ["write"]}}
{"return": {}}
{"execute": "blockdev-backup", "arguments": {"device": "source", "sync": "full", "target": "target"}}
-{"error": {"class": "GenericError", "desc": "Cannot set permissions for backup-top filter: Conflicts with use by source as 'image', which does not allow 'write' on base"}}
+{"error": {"class": "GenericError", "desc": "Cannot append backup-top filter: Conflicts with use by source as 'image', which does not allow 'write' on base"}}
